Rejected petition Start Meningitis B vaccine catch-up for all teenagers and young adults
I call on the U.K. government to introduce a Meningitis B catch-up vaccination scheme for all teenagers and young adults at university.
The Men B vaccine was introduced
for babies in 2015. Teenagers & young adults who are at great risk from this deadly disease have not been eligible
More details
My brother died from Men B at 16. Now there is a vaccine available for this Men B this should be provided to all teenagers & young adults to prevent death or permanent disability. No family should have to go through what we went through.
Men B accounts for 86.2% of cases of meningitis in the U.K. and was the cause of all meningococcal disease cases in 15 to 19 year olds in 2024/25. It has a death rate of 10%
